@acapella @Unknown Desconocido You're not wrong, a $100 Reverse gear sensor went bad that was internal to the transmission. Replacing the DSG's Mechatronic unit (valve body) fixes about 50% of the cars (did not for me). Local Audi dealer quoted a $18,000 (post tax) bill for a new transmission & install. After it broke for the 3rd time, I acquired a used trans w/ low mileage to replace it....$8k later, still my all-time favorite car, & will most likely never sell. @@StillSoundAmazing I can say, that it's a great choice if you want the quattro system and aren't going to miss sliding a rear wheel drive car like an M3. Mpg will average 15, as you'll never want to close the valves and stay in comfort mode because of the sheer sound (I've set off car alarms on some occasions.) I've only seen one other Rs5 since I've owned mine over a period of six months (which was at a car event) so it's a great for something unique (unlike an M4.) Fuel dumps between gear changes in the exhaust sound meaty, hitting the rev limiter sounds like a machine gun. Consider the Rs4 Estate if you're in Europe, same engine, what I originally was going to buy as they look amazing. Be wary of heavy understeer if you're pushing it too hard into a tight corner! Won't be just as fast as the new turbocharged competitors, but really you're buying this this thing for the legendary V8. Hope this helps!

I know this comment is late to the party, but I wanted to drive my B9 RS5 enough to give my 2 cent’s. As a former B8.5 RS5 owner who traded it in for the new B9 RS5. So many people get hung up on the B9 being a V6 vs V8. The new RS5 would dog out my B8.5 easily. The B8.5 had no torque for how heavy it was and in day to day driving you need torque over HP. Plus, I have the Sport Exhaust and it doesn’t sound bad at all and I can always get a aftermarket exhaust. I also had a Stage 2 B8.5 S4 that would have smoked my B8.5 RS5. While the B8.5 RS5 is a beautiful car still, much like the B7 RS4, the new RS5 just pulls like crazy when you need it. I can’t wait to slap a tune on it, something that you can’t really do and get any numbers out of it on the NA V8. Just saying.
